Hi people, hoping you can spread some light on the above, 2002 Laguna dci Estate, started knocking from front end last week, NEVER had any problems to date, always serviced regular and all work done - Mechanic next door has had a good look round and reckons it dosent sound mechanical, more like something loose or catching - dissapears at about 40+ mph - water, oil all fine and stills drives great. Any help or pointers greatly appreciated as I dont want to put kids in until ok - THANKS PEOPLE
Edited by Dynamic Dave on 24/02/2009 at 18:54
|
Can you isolate it to engine / suspension / gearbox?
I.e. does it stop when you clutch? Can you generate the noise by "bouncing" the corners of the car? How about manuvering slowly on full steering lock?
James
|
Drop links or anti roll bar bushes are worth looking at.
